Finding Your Corned Beef & Cabbage: Delivery & Pick-Up
Several avenues exist for securing your corned beef and cabbage, catering to various needs and preferences. Here’s a breakdown:
* **Online Meal Delivery Services:** Platforms like Goldbelly specialize in delivering iconic dishes from restaurants and delis nationwide. This is a great option if you’re craving a specific restaurant’s version or want to try something unique.
* **Local Restaurants and Delis:** Don’t forget your neighborhood favorites! Many local establishments, particularly Irish pubs and delis, offer corned beef and cabbage for takeout or delivery, especially around St. Patrick’s Day. Check their websites or call to confirm.
* **Grocery Stores with Prepared Meals:** Many grocery chains now offer prepared meals, including corned beef and cabbage, especially leading up to St. Patrick’s Day. This is a convenient option for a quick and easy dinner.
* **Meal Kit Services:** Some meal kit companies offer special St. Patrick’s Day meals, including corned beef and cabbage. These kits provide pre-portioned ingredients and easy-to-follow recipes, allowing you to enjoy a home-cooked meal with minimal effort.

Tips for Ordering
* **Order in Advance:** Corned beef and cabbage is a popular dish, especially around St. Patrick’s Day. Ordering in advance ensures you don’t miss out.
* **Check Delivery Areas and Times:** Confirm that the restaurant or service delivers to your location and that the delivery time works for you.
* **Read Reviews:** Before ordering from a new place, read online reviews to get an idea of the quality of the food and service.
* **Consider Portion Sizes:** Pay attention to the portion sizes offered to ensure you order enough for everyone.
* **Inquire About Sides:** Find out what sides are included with the meal. Some places may offer traditional sides like potatoes, carrots, and Irish soda bread.
FAQ Section: Your Corned Beef & Cabbage Questions Answered
* **Q: How much does corned beef and cabbage typically cost to order?**
* A: The price can vary widely depending on the restaurant, portion size, and delivery fees. Expect to pay anywhere from $20 to $50 for a meal that serves two people.
* **Q: Can I order corned beef and cabbage for a large group?**
* A: Yes, many restaurants and caterers offer corned beef and cabbage platters or packages for larger groups. Contact them directly to discuss your needs.
* **Q: How far in advance should I order?**
* A: It’s best to order at least a few days in advance, especially if you’re ordering for St. Patrick’s Day. Some popular restaurants may require even more advance notice.
* **Q: What if I have dietary restrictions?**
* A: Contact the restaurant or service directly to inquire about ingredients and preparation methods. They may be able to accommodate dietary restrictions like gluten-free or dairy-free.
* **Q: Is it better to pick up or have it delivered?**
* A: That depends on your preference and convenience. Pick-up can save you on delivery fees, while delivery is more convenient if you don’t want to leave your home.
